First things first: I grew up in Belgium, about 30 min. away from where this movie is set (in and around Ghent, Belgium). I had heard great things about this movie through various Belgian connections, but had never had a chance to see it, until now.
"Moscow, Belgium" (106 min.; originally released in 2009) brings the daily struggles of a 41 yr. old woman, Matty, whose husband has moved out due to a fling with a 22 yr. former student. Matty meets Johnny as a result of a car accident in a parking lot, and unexpectedly takes a liking to this much younger man (29 yrs). Things develop from there. Not much really happens, other than to observe the characters in their daily life, and this is not a complaint, mind ya. Matty tries to handle her 3 kids and her husband, while at the same trying to figure out if much younger Johnny, who has himself some skelletons from the past, can really be the one for her. You'll just have to see for yourself how it all plays out. In all, I was incredibly pleased with this movie, and yes proud (being from Belgium). Who would've thunk it that such a great movie could've been made in Belgium? Special shout-out to Barbara Sarafian as Matty and Anemone Valcke a her 17 yr. old daughter, both of whom bring fantastic performances. This movie picked up a bunch of awards at various fims festivals (including Cannes), and for good reason. By all means, check this out!

This was in my opinion probably one of the best films of 2009, and definitely one of the best Rom-Com with a refreshingly plausible meet-cute and "real" people. The film is at 94% on RottenTomatoes, and won the Critic's Week section at the Cannes Film Festival. The acting is top notch, with an oscar caliber performance by the lead, Barbara Sarafian, and the direction is wisely understated. The script is just filled with humanity and life.
Can you tell I loved it? Also a great original score which I hope will be available at some point on amazon.
